Aivaras Tušas

from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ia

Aivaras Tušas (born January 14, 1976 in the district of Ukmergė ) is a Lithuanian politician, vice minister .

Life

After graduating from high school in Taujėnai near Ukmergė , Tušas completed a bachelor's degree in mechanics from 1994 to 1998 at the Kauno technologijos universitetas . From 2001 to 2003 he studied English at the London Academy ( Cambridge FCE). From 2008 to 2009 he was the logistics manager of " Recycling Clothes Company Ltd" and from 2009 to 2012 director of "Ader United Ltd". From January 2013 to October 2013 he was Deputy Minister of Social Affairs of Lithuania as deputy of Algimanta Pabedinskienė in the Butkevičius cabinet .
